This practical course provides comprehensive frameworks and techniques for identifying, analyzing, engaging, and managing stakeholders in public sector contexts. Participants will learn to develop stakeholder strategies that build support, manage expectations, and mitigate risks throughout project and policy lifecycles. The program covers communication planning, relationship building, and conflict resolution techniques specific to complex public sector environments with diverse and often competing stakeholder interests. Through case studies and role-playing exercises, professionals will develop capabilities to navigate stakeholder landscapes effectively and achieve outcomes that balance multiple perspectives and priorities.
